This episode focuses on Scientific investigations.Through watching this episode, teachers will discover that for learners to succesfully carry out scientific investigations, they require a range of process skills such as observation, making measurements,classifying and recording data, interpreting information and communicating findings. The episode shows a classroom activity where learners practically carry out a scientific investigation on how to strengthen paper.
